Product Description

Molecular sieve can classfied into zeolit molecular sieve and carbon molecular sieve.

Molecular sieve 3A is a type of zeolit molecular sieve in spherical or strip-shaped adsorbent,with pore size of 0.3

nanometers. It is mainly used for adsorbing water and does not adsorb any molecules with a diameter greater than 0.3

nanometers. It is the preferred drying agent necessary for deep drying, refining, and polymerization of gas-liquid phases in

the petroleum and chemical industries.

3.Typical Application

a) Drying of unsaturated hydrocarbons (e.g. ethylene, propylene, butadien)

b) Cracked Gas Drying

c) Drying of natural gas, if COS minimization is essential, or a minimum co-adsorption of hydrocarbons is required.

d) Drying of highly polar compounds, such as methanol and ethanol

e) Drying of liquid alcohol

f) Static, (non-regenerative) dehydration of insulating glass units, whether air filled or gas-filled.

g) Drying of CNG.
